AMMSM: Adaptive Motion Magnification and Sparse Mamba for Micro-Expression Recognition

微表情是人真实情绪的无意识表现,但持续时间短、信号微弱,给下游识别带来挑战。本文提出多任务学习框架AMMSM,通过自监督方式增强微表情的细微运动信号,同时采用稀疏空间选择的Mamba架构,结合先进的视觉Mamba模型,更有效地建模关键运动区域及其特征表示。此外,利用进化搜索优化运动放大系数和空间稀疏比例,再通过微调进一步提升性能。在两个标准数据集上的大量实验表明,所提方法在准确率和鲁棒性方面均达到当前最优水平。

Micro-expressions are typically regarded as unconscious manifestations of a person's genuine emotions. However, their short duration and subtle signals pose significant challenges for downstream recognition. We propose a multi-task learning framework named the Adaptive Motion Magnification and Sparse Mamba (AMMSM) to address this. This framework aims to enhance the accurate capture of micro-expressions through self-supervised subtle motion magnification, while the sparse spatial selection Mamba architecture combines sparse activation with the advanced Visual Mamba model to model key motion regions and their valuable representations more effectively. Additionally, we employ evolutionary search to optimize the magnification factor and the sparsity ratios of spatial selection, followed by fine-tuning to improve performance further. Extensive experiments on two standard datasets demonstrate that the proposed AMMSM achieves state-of-the-art (SOTA) accuracy and robustness.
